Nepal is extremely diverse culturally, but its population can be divided roughly into two main language groups 1. Learn vocabulary, terms, and more with flashcards, games, and other study tools. The indoaryan group is politically and culturally predominant and mainly hindu, living mostly in the hills and southern plains.
